
A New Dawn for Senior Living in the Great Lakes
In a promising development for the senior living landscape, Mimi Senior Living has officially launched its boutique management and consulting firm in central Ohio, aiming to serve the broader Great Lakes region. Designed specifically to uplift the quality of senior living, Mimi Senior Living seeks to cater to owners and investors across Indiana, Kentucky, Michigan, Ohio, and Pennsylvania.
Chief Operating Officer and Principal, Stephanie Hess, expressed her enthusiasm for the company's launch, emphasizing the need for excellence in managing senior living facilities. "It’s just back to the basics," she stated, underlining the importance of combining compassionate care with modern technology. Mimi Senior Living aims to redefine the operational standards in senior housing by specializing not only in managing stabilized properties but also in enhancing underperforming communities through a mix of acquisitions, ground-up developments, and strategic turnaround initiatives.
A Heartfelt Mission Inspired by Family
The firm’s name, Mimi Senior Living, carries deep personal significance for Hess. Named in honour of her late sister, a nurse and resident advocate, the name reflects the ongoing commitment to compassionate care. "She did such a great job of taking care of people, and this can inspire us to remember why we do what we do," Hess said. This personal touch emphasizes a human-centered approach to care, highlighting the passionate commitment that drives the team at Mimi.
Innovations in Senior Living Technology
One of the standout priorities for Mimi Senior Living is its tech strategy. Hess recognized that the senior living industry often lags in technological advancements, which can hinder quality care. Herself having experienced the integration of technology during her previous roles, she decided that this firm would take the necessary time to select the best tech tools that cater specifically to seniors’ needs. Leveraging technology will allow caretakers to provide better care while streamlining daily operations.
"We can spend more time taking care of residents and less time figuring things out for ourselves," Hess said, emphasizing that technology should empower caregivers rather than hinder them.
Lessons from Professional Experience
Hess's journey in senior living has been a remarkable one, beginning as a caregiver during her college years. Armed with a degree in long-term care administration and a master's in health administration, her diverse experience across various facets of senior living—ranging from nursing homes to assisted living—has given her invaluable insights into what makes a quality senior community. She has worked diligently in independent living, memory care, and assisted living, gaining firsthand knowledge about the needs and challenges families face when choosing senior living options.
Community-Centric Identity
As the firm prepares to support local senior living communities, it's not just about financial success but about cultivating a culture of care. The Mimi Senior Living team is composed of industry veterans, including Betty Ronoh, RN, the executive vice president of clinical operations, and Matt Loges, LNHA, the executive vice president of strategic initiatives. Their experience adds depth to the firm's mission—ensuring high-quality care aligns with efficient management.
Additionally, the firm emphasizes market feasibility studies and operational assessments, key tools that not only enhance value but also ensure compliance with necessary regulations while enriching the experience for both residents and staff.
